South Central MN | You can plug a mouse and keyboard into the USB ports and they will work. The keyboard especially has been very handy as I'm in the process of remaking all of our field boundary guidance lines.
Only warning is that it appears that a certain certain key on the keyboard can cause the monitor to shutdown. I've bumped the keyboard twice and both times the screen went black and shut down, but I don't know what key I pushed. I'm guessing it's a key unsupported by the monitor such as the windows key, but haven't figured it out yet.
Even with the glitch, it's well worth having the keyboard when entering tons of names instead of using the touch screen. | |
